An odd number n of agents are located along the line interval [0,1] and must decide where to build a sports centre in that interval. The preferences of agent i (i=1,2,...,n) are represented by the utility function U1(x) = 1 - x - xil, where x = [0,1] denotes the location of the sports centre and x/ € [0,1] is the location of agent i's home. The collective decision is made by minimizing the sum of the distances between the centre and the agents' homes.

a) Draw the utility function of a representative agent.

b) Is the chosen location a Condorcet winner? Explain your answer.
